当前位置: 首页>>技术教程>>正文


防止 gnome-shell 的破折号列出最近的项目

问题描述

我在 Ubuntu 11.10 中使用 gnome-shell 。当破折号搜索列出最近的项目时,我很生气。我已经尝试了很多方法来防止它像

  • 删除~/.local/share/zeitgeist下的activity.sqliteactivity.sqlite-journal文件

  • Activity Log Manager 中添加所有可能的条目以防止应用程序日志记录

  • Activity Log Manager 中指定时间范围以忘记我的活动。

但这些方法都不起作用。最近的项目列表仍然被填充。

除了上述方法之外,还有什么方法可以告诉 dash 在搜索时不要列出最近的项目?或者有什么办法可以删除最近的项目列表?

最佳回答

Gnome-shell 使用 recently-used 而不是 Zeitgeist 来显示您最近的项目。

要禁用它,请按照以下步骤操作:

删除 recently-used.xbel:

rm ~/.local/share/recently-used.xbel

创建一个新的空文件:

touch ~/.local/share/recently-used.xbel

确保新文件不能被修改:

sudo chattr +i ~/.local/share/recently-used.xbel

现在,您对最近项目的显示消失了。

如果要还原,请删除 recently-used.xbel 的 i 属性:

sudo chattr -i ~/.local/share/recently-used.xbel

所有学分:http://knezevblog.blogspot.com/2010/05/how-to-ubuntu-clear-and-disable-recent.html

参考资料

本文由Ubuntu问答整理, 博文地址: https://ubuntuqa.com/article/13101.html,未经允许,请勿转载。